Nice very dark brown, almost but not quite black in appearance with a large foamy light beige colored head that appears like seafoam as it settles and eventually dissipates.
Has an aroma of toasted nuts with slight citrus-like brightness on the end; kind of wish it tasted the same but it tastes mostly like smoke and char with a hint of oak and peat; the peat note phases between peat and root vegetables like carrot. I think this brew has a lot of promise but kind of falls flat in the flavor arena; it's not bad though, it would probably go great with a good burger or grilled meats! It's worth a try and could potentially be awesome with the right meal! :) It also gets a bit better after warming up a little bit
Mouthfeel is fizzy-sizzly, which makes the flavor dance on the tongue; I like it the effect but would prefer some more nuanced flavors to decipher to go along with it
Would I purchase or order this again? Possibly! This brew makes me believe that the brewery holds a lot of promise through innovation
